LETS ALL WRITE A CHRISTMAS GEARSLUTZ SONG

LETS ALL WRITE A CHRISTMAS GEARSLUTZ SONG!!!!

It's going to be 125 bpm and 16 bars long:

These are the chords:

G.../G.../Em.../Am.../

C.../C.../G.../G.../

Am.../G.../Am.G./F.../

C.../F.../C.../C.../ repeat ad infinitum

and the rhythm is going to be like any xmas song, kind of dum-de-dum-de-dum slaybell ringing rhythm, like the rhythm to 'Winter Wonderland' for instance.

One PART only please per person. It could be a rhythm guitar track, an insane drum loop, a lead line on a saxophone, even a frog chorus! But when I say one PART I mean it, don't give me a bunch of stuff (although of course you may track something up to make it 'meaty' )

I will assemble all the parts myself and mix them to try and create something seasonal.

I will ATTEMPT to add nothing myself i.e. Use only the audio I am given.

Consulting each other on what each of you are contributing is strictly forbidden. The fun is to see if I can get all these disparate elements to work together. Without cheating. Too much.

Send all contributions as AIFF files to me:

bev@julianbevmoore.com

with a precise GEARSLUTZ type description of how and what you recorded i.e. This is Dave from the Buttmunchers in my studio playing a '68 Telecaster through blah blah lots of equipment signal path etc...

I will try to post up the finished product before next Thursday if you all get into the swing of it, and will incorporate as much as is (un)musically possible.

And if, as I'm going, I realise that I could actually do with a particular something, I will post a request up here.

Yes, of course, it will be dreadful, but hey, it's xmas!!!

Bev

P.S. And don't forget, AIFF's only. And ONLY 16 bars long, I don't want someone playing the kazoo for 13 passes cluttering up my inbox!
